Site work, paving, outdoor lighting and renovation of a mixed-use development in Sterling, Virginia. Completed plans call for the renovation of a educational facility; for site work for a sidewalk / parking lot; for outdoor lighting for a sidewalk / parking lot; and for paving for a sidewalk / parking lot.

Sealed bids are invited for the construction of LR Building Reconfigure Loading Dock at the Loudoun campus of Northern Virginia Community College, 21200 Campus Drive, Sterling, VA 20164. The project is generally described as the construction of an ADA compliant sidewalk, reworking a loading dock pavement area and additional lighting. The project is generally described as demolition and construction of ADA accessible route between the LS and LR buildings on the northern end of campus, designation of fire truck access route near loading dock, configuration of police parking spaces, and replacement of three existing light poles with four new light poles. Location- 21200 Campus Dr Sterling, VA 20164 A Bid Bond is required. Performance & Payment Bonds will be required regardless of contract amount. Procedures for submitting a bid, claiming an error, withdrawal of bids and other pertinent information are contained in the Instructions to Bidders, which is part of the Invitation for Bids. Withdrawal due to error in bid shall be permitted in accord with Section 9 of the Instructions to Bidders and 2.2-4330, Code of Virginia. The Owner reserves the right to reject any or all bids. The contract shall be awarded on a lump sum basis as follows: Total Base Bid Amount including any properly submitted and received bid modifications. 'Notice of Award' or 'Notice of Intent to Award' will be posted online. Contractor registration is required in accordance with Section 54.1-1103 of the Code of Virginia. See the Invitation for Bids for additional qualification requirements. All executive branch agencies are directed to advance Executive Order 35, dated July 3, 2019 Substantial Completion of the entire project shall be _75 consecutive calendar days + Final Completion shall be achieved within 30 consecutive calendar days after the date of Substantial Completion as determined by the A/E Question Deadline 08/08/2025 No oral explanation in regard to the meaning of drawings and specifications will be made and no oral instructions will be given before the award of the Contract. Bidders must so act to assure that questions reach the A/E at least six (6)days prior to the time set for the receipt of bids to allow a sufficient time for an addendum to reach all bidders before the submission of their bids.
